Abstract:

beta-NaYF4:Yb3+,Er3+ microrods were synthesized through hydrothermal methods. Polyethylene glycol with molecular weight of 6000 was used as surfactant. A series of transparent silica gel films with upconversion luminescence property was prepared through, sol-gel method; the prepared beta-NaYF4:Yb3+,Er3+ microrods were used as activator. The silica gel films show strong upconversion emission under excitation of 980-nm laser beam.
